    I have never, ever seen a gerbil get bigger than a rat. They get bigger than mice, but not by much. Definitely smaller than rats.

    Ginevive...I'm with Marla and would consider gerbils only as a last resort. The "used bedding" suggestion from Raj is a very good idea to try. However, if you're willing to commit to feeding gerbils full-time, and you can get them easily and relatively inexpensively, there is nothing wrong with trying them as well. And they're not terribly hard to breed, either. I did it as a kid without even trying. :shock: They're a LOT cleaner than mice, or even rats.
